css3 滚轮滚动动画
导读:CSS3是网页设计中非常重要的一个技术,其中滚轮滚动动画是一种常见的应用。当用户使用滚轮滚动页面时,网页中的某些元素会随之动态变化。使用CSS3能够实现非常流畅动画效果,使得页面更加生动有趣。其中一种实现滚轮滚动动画的方法是使用CSS3的t...
CSS3是网页设计中非常重要的一个技术,其中滚轮滚动动画是一种常见的应用。当用户使用滚轮滚动页面时,网页中的某些元素会随之动态变化。使用CSS3能够实现非常流畅动画效果,使得页面更加生动有趣。
其中一种实现滚轮滚动动画的方法是使用CSS3的transform属性。在下面的代码示例中,我们定义了一个类名为“scroll-animation”的CSS样式,将其应用于网页的某一元素上。当用户滚动鼠标滚轮时,该元素将会以一定的速度实现视觉的移动效果。
.scroll-animation{
transition: transform 1s ease;
}
.scroll-animation[data-scroll]{
transform: translateY(-100vh);
}
body[data-scroll="up"] .scroll-animation[data-scroll]{
transform: translateY(0);
}
body[data-scroll="down"] .scroll-animation[data-scroll]{
transform: translateY(-200vh);
}
在上述代码中,我们使用了CSS3的transition属性来定义元素的动画过渡方式。同时,我们通过在元素上设置data-scroll属性来判断滚动方向,进而实现元素的滚动动画效果。
总的来说,CSS3的滚轮滚动动画是一种非常具有实用价值的技术。它能够在网页设计中实现很多独特的动画效果,提高了用户体验和网页使用的便捷性,有助于网页的更好传播和推广。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css3 滚轮滚动动画
本文地址: https://pptw.com/jishu/568013.html
